    Experience

    Electricians are responsible for telecom and power systems in residential, commercial and industrial buildings. They install new electrical wiring, repair damaged circuits and perform maintenance on the equipment they have.

    They employ a variety of tools and hand tools to protect and run wiring as well as to resolve any issues that may arise. They use ammeters, voltage meters, and thermal scanners for examining circuits and find potential problems.

    Many electricians work alone Some are part of a team working on larger projects. They may collaborate with architects or building engineers to design electrical wiring for new construction projects.

    In the event that they work alone or as part of teams, electricians must have great communication skills to ensure that projects are completed on time and according to clients' specifications. They must be able to communicate clearly about schedule and repair procedures to clients, as explaining the technical details to them.

    If they're leaders electricians must have strong project management skills to ensure that their teams can complete projects within the timeframe and in line with company standards. They need to monitor the progress and adjust schedules as well as manage conflicts when they occur to ensure that projects do not get behind.

    They should also be able to effectively communicate with their team members to allow them to work in tandem. This requires team leadership and organizational skills, as they will need to determine how many electricians are needed at each job site and who is accountable for what.

    When electricians' salaries experience is typically more important that education. The National Electrical Contractors Association estimates that experienced electricians earn 40 percent more than entry-level electricians.

    To qualify for an electrician's license, candidates must successfully complete a state-approved school program or apprenticeship. These programs offer 144 hours of technical training every year, as well as 2,000 hours on-the-job experience.

    The process of becoming an electrician involves a variety of subjects of study. These include blueprints safety and first-aid procedures as well as the requirements of the electrical code. In addition, candidates must take courses in mathematics and electrical theory.

    Insurance

    There are many kinds of insurance you could purchase for your business. These include workers' comp, general liability, and property insurance. These policies are designed to protect your employees and you from financial loss.





    The size of your company and the kind of coverage you select will affect the cost of your electrician's insurance policy. Bundling your coverage into an insurance policy for business owners (BOP) can help you save money.

    While electricians aren't legally required to carry insurance in most states, it's an ideal idea to carry insurance. In the absence of insurance it could result in penalties. In commercial electricians near me of a lawsuit, this insurance will help pay for legal expenses and other losses arising from the claim.

    A common type of electrician insurance is general liability, which covers your company from claims from third parties. General liability insurance will protect your business from property damage as well as injuries to the body caused by negligence or faulty work. It is also possible to purchase insurance to safeguard your business against personal injury claims made by employees who work on your site.

    Professional indemnity insurance is an additional important type of insurance that is required for an electrician. This insurance safeguards your business from being sued by a client for an error you committed during your work, like a faulty circuit or the loss of vital documents.
